You can paste text like \o/ into the line and get "characters removed: /\". We
could name it "The following character(s) is/are not valid." but this has
negative bearing on readability and is a common usability issue.
The best solution is to allow wrong characters but warn immediately without
interrupting the workflow. Typically done by a red text next to the input. And
the confirmation action (okay button, double-click, context menu) is disabled.
